About This Game

You have been invited to observe yourself.

PROJECT: MIRROR is a single-player psychological horror narrative game presented through social feeds, CRT terminals, official documents, simulations, and consent protocols.

An AI system called MIRROR asks for your judgment. At first, the questions are familiar: who lives, who dies, what choice saves the most people. Then the scale changes. A person becomes a group. A group becomes a district. A district becomes a continent. Eventually, the question is no longer what is moral.

It is what can be justified.

Observation Protocol

  • Enter a public beta that begins inside a familiar social media interface.

  • Answer ethical dilemmas while MIRROR compares your choices against a simulated collective pattern.

  • Process resource requests in a city where every signature spends what cannot be replaced.

  • Requisition planetary regions to complete an escape project before time runs out.

  • Intervene in a climate system where every solution creates another failure.

  • Review survival protocols that turn consent into classification.

No Monsters. No Chase. No Safe Answer.

PROJECT: MIRROR is horror through procedure.

The pressure comes from clean interfaces, official language, impossible shortages, and the moment when a terrible option starts to sound reasonable. You are not asked to defeat evil. You are asked to keep making decisions after every good answer has been removed.

AI Generated Content Disclosure

The developers describe how their game uses AI Generated Content like this:

Generative AI tools were used during development to assist with drafting, editing, and localization support for some in-game text, including support for selected non-English language content. AI tools were also used as part of the development workflow. All in-game text, localization, and store materials are reviewed and approved by the developer before release.

The game does not generate AI content during gameplay and does not connect to any external AI service while being played.

Mature Content Description

The developers describe the content like this:

PROJECT: MIRROR contains psychological horror and mature thematic content. The game includes written and stylized depictions of violence, death, mass-casualty scenarios, resource deprivation, civilian harm, war-crime scenarios, and ethical choices involving vulnerable groups such as refugees and children. Later sections include themes of forced selection, loss of autonomy, body modification, and AI control.

The game does not contain sexual content, nudity, sexual assault, drug abuse, or graphic gore.
